As part of the Punjab Land Record Modernization Project 2025, the Punjab government is surveying Khanewal’s land from door to door. The survey’s objectives include updating and correcting outdated land records and transferring all data to a computerized system. To gather information, confirm ownership, and correct mistakes, the Punjab Land Record Authority (PLRA) will visit farms, villages, and residences.
What Makes This Survey Vital?
In order to prevent land grabbing and fraud, update land records, eliminate outdated inaccuracies, and develop digital records for residents, the Punjab Land Record Authority (PLRA) is undertaking a land survey. By helping farmers, decreasing bribery and fraud, and making land ownership easily accessible, the survey seeks to make Punjab’s land record system equitable and transparent for all.

How Will the Survey Group Proceed?
PLRA Home Visits
• Requesting CNIC (ID card).
• Gathering land documents.
• Obtaining Khasra number or map of land.
• Obtaining proof of land ownership.
• Using GPS and digital tools for land area comparison.
Documents You Must Always Have on Hand
Preparing for Land Process:
• CNIC (Computerized National Identity Card)
• Original land documents (registry or fard)
• Land map or khasra number (if available)
• Old tax receipts or related papers.

Watch Out for False Agents
Land Data Collection Guidelines
• Only authorized PLRA survey teams collect land data.
• Always request official ID.
• No payment required.
• Service is free.

FAQs
1. Is there no charge for the land survey service?
Yes, this survey is being provided by the Punjab Land Record Authority (PLRA) at no cost at all. At no point is money necessary. Report anybody who asks for money right away.
2. Which papers do I need to have on hand for the survey team?
The following documents should be prepared by you:
- Computed National Identity Card, or CNIC
- Original land records, such as a fard or registration
- If accessible, a land map or Khasra number
- Tax receipts from the past or any other supporting documentation
3. After the survey, how can I confirm my land record?
You may view your most recent land information here:
- Visit Punjab-Zameen.gov.pk online.
- By SMS: Text 8400 with your CNIC number.
- Go to the Tehsil Arazi Record Center that is closest to you.
